Tony Award-Winning Broadway Hit Transfers to the Barbican for Limited Seven-Week Run
Following a critically acclaimed Broadway run, the smash hit play Good Night, Oscar will receive its West End premiere this summer at the Barbican Theatre, opening on 31 July 2025 for a limited seven-week engagement. Sean Hayes will reprise his Tony Award-winning role as Oscar Levant, joined by Ben Rappaport as Jack Paar in a reunion of their celebrated Broadway performances.
Written by Pulitzer Prize winner Doug Wright and directed by Lisa Peterson, the play explores themes of celebrity, mental health and genius through the lens of a historic late-night television appearance.
A Sharp, Witty Portrait of a Complicated Icon
Set in 1958, Good Night, Oscar centres on Oscar Levant, a brilliant but troubled concert pianist, actor, and humorist. Invited to appear live on The Tonight Show by its host Jack Paar, Levant delivers an interview that shocks and captivates the nation. The play masterfully explores the complexities of artistic genius, personal pain, and public perception.
Sean Hayes’s performance as Levant earned him the 2023 Tony Award for Best Leading Actor in a Play, with critics hailing his portrayal as “mesmerising” and “transformative.” Ben Rappaport, currently seen in NBC’s Grosse Pointe Garden Society, returns as Paar, praised on Broadway for balancing charm and sharpness in the role.
New West End Casting Announced
Joining Hayes and Rappaport for the London run are:
Daniel Adeosun as Alvin Finney
David Burnett as George Gershwin
Richard Katz as Bob Sarnoff
Eric Sirakian as Max Weinbaum
Max Roll returns as understudy for Oscar Levant and Bob Sarnoff
Understudies include Tashinga Bepete, Ben Butler, Charlotte Hunter, and Ryan Speakman.
